With packet-based technologies rapidly evolving to match carrier-grade transport standards, the migration from legacy TDM to packet switched networks is currently underway.

Today, Multiprotocol Label Switching (IP/MPLS) is considered to be the leading packet transport networking technology. Just like Provider Backbone Bridging Traffic Engineering (PBB-TE) extended existing Ethernet standards in the core network, MPLS is being made more transport-oriented by the newly defined and still evolving MPLS Transport Profile (MPLS-TP) standard, which is expected to provide a cost effective solution. However, adoption of MPLS-TP is still at its infancy as the finer aspects of the standards are still being worked on.
